Peter journeys to Ego's utopian planet to discover his true heritage, while his teammates grow suspicious of Ego's ultimate motives. Guardians Of The Galaxy Vol 2 Tamil Dubbed Movie

The film features many of the same characters and themes that made the first film so beloved, including the nostalgic soundtrack, which features classic hits from the 1970s. The film also introduces new characters, such as Mantis, a powerful empath played by Pom Klementieff, and Nebula, Gamora's troubled sister played by Karen Gillan.

The strength of the Tamil dub lies in its treatment of Drax and Mantis. Drax, who takes everything literally, was given the speech patterns of a pattikaattu (village) simpleton—his insult comedy translated into earthy, almost Muthuraman-esque barbs. When he calls Mantis “beautiful” because she is “hideous on the inside,” the Tamil line became “ Un ullam athana azhagu, un mugam athana azhagillai ” (Your heart is so beautiful, your face is the opposite)—a classic Kollywood putdown.
